Witryna133K views 2 years ago Data Structures and Algorithms Course in Hindi Coding Linked representation of Binary Tree: In this video we will see how to code binary tree in C … Witryna7 sie 2024 · In this question, we are given the level order traversal of a binary tree, in the form of a linked list. We have to construct the complete binary tree from its linked list representation. Suppose the given linked list is 10 -> 12 -> 13 -> 23 -> 30 -> 36. For each i th node, its children are the (2i+1) th and (2i+2) nd nodes of the list.

Given an array that represents a tree in such a way that array indexes are values in tree nodes and array values give the parent node of that particular index (or node). The value of the root node index would always be -1 as there is no parent for root.
